How to Choose the Best Coffee Beans for You

Choosing by Roast Level

  • Dark roasted coffee beans

    Dark Roast

    Dark roasted coffee beans typically have strong, bold flavour with a slight smokiness. The body of the coffee is often smooth and syrupy, with a low acidity.

  • medium-dark roasted coffee beans

    Medium-dark Roast

    Medium-dark roast offers fuller body and more intense flavour than a medium roast. You'll be able to taste the subtle nuances of the coffee beans, mild acidity, and a hint of sweetness.

  • medium roast coffee beans

    Medium Roast

    Medium roast showcases the true flavour of single origin beans. It offers light body and higher acidity often accompanied by subtle citrus notes.

Single or Blend?

  • Single Origin Coffee

    Single origin coffee is sources from a single geographic location. These are often higher quality and offer a unique flavour profile that is reflective of the specific region they come from.

  • Coffee Blends

    A coffee blend combines two or more coffees to create a delicious, unique flavour that you can't find in a single-origin coffee. They're popular with cafes and coffee shops because their flavour remains consistent throughout the year.

What is the best way to store coffee beans?

When you buy freshly roasted coffee beans, you need to make sure that you store them correctly so that they retain their fresh flavour. You should keep them in an airtight container since too much exposure over time to moisture, air, and oxygen can severely affect their quality and may make your coffee taste stale. 

If you buy coffee beans that come in a resealable bag like ours, then you can store them here.

You should put your coffee beans in a cool, dark place in your home, like a cupboard. The further away from heat sources such as ovens, the better, as there is less risk of your beans getting damaged and they'll have longer-lasting freshness.
